Cracked Wheat Thins

  1. Pour boiling water over Red River Cereal.
  2. Allow to soak for 30 minutes.
  3. Combine shortening and sugar.
  4. Add flour and salt.
  5. Add the soaked grain. You might need a bit more water to get the right consistency.
  6. Divide dough into four parts and roll each as thin as parchment.
  7. Slide dough onto ungreased cookie sheet and indent it in squares with a pastry wheel or knife.
  8. Prick dough all over with force to prevent bubbling.
  9. Bake 400F 10 minutes.
  10. Remove, and break biscuits where you have them scored.
  11. For variety can add poppy seed, onion flakes, garlic powder, cayenne or paprika.

whole wheat flour, sugar, vegetable shortening, red river cereal, boiling water, salt
